## Deployment notes

Heads up: Datelark now localizes date formats per region at render time instead of baking them in at build. That means each deploy target needs its locale bundle mounted before the app starts, or everything falls back to ISO dates. The current per-environment settings are listed right below.

service settings:
druael:
  pin: 7528
  metrics_host: metrics.druael.lumiclabs.internal
  tenant: wendor
  seal: seal_c765840a

## Configuration

Ledgerpin corrects rounding drift in currency conversion by reconciling against the quote cache every minute. Relevant vars in `ledgerpin.env`: `ROUND_MODE=bankers`, `DRIFT_TOLERANCE_MINOR=2`, `RECONCILE_INTERVAL_SEC=60`. Review these for tampering; drift tolerance above 5 is a red flag. The reconciler authenticates to the rates vault with a credential set on the next line of the file.

env line for bagap-yajep: COURIER_KEY20=b4db4e5e33a646898766

**Alert: puzzle-gen-stall**

This one fires when the Gridsmith crossword generator takes longer than 90 seconds to produce a valid grid. Usually it means the wordlist service is slow or someone pushed an overly strict theme constraint. Check the gen-workers dashboard first, then roll back the latest constraint config if needed. Don't panic — it self-recovers about half the time. Escalations go here.

escalation mailbox, yajeg-bageg: quenax.olidor@lumiccorp.internal

# Environments: PinPoint Autocomplete

Three environments: dev, staging, prod. Dev resets nightly. Staging mirrors prod data minus the Harwick dataset. Promotions go dev → staging → prod; no direct prod pushes. Staging smoke tests must pass before release sign-off. Prod config is locked behind change review. Current staging values are as follows.

settings of kafop-fahog:
PRAWYN_PIN=8793
PRAWYN_METRICS_HOST=metrics.prawyn.lumiccorp.corp
PRAWYN_LOG_LEVEL=warn
PRAWYN_TENANT=kasox